MEASURE Action — During this phase of the SDM cycle, the measurement pro-
cess takes place. If the repeat filter is enabled, as shown in the blow-up drawing
for Measure Action, the instrument samples the specified number of reading con-
versions to yield a single filtered reading (measurement). If using the moving filter
or if the filter is disabled, only a single reading conversion will yield a reading.
Counters
Programmable counters are used to repeat operations within the trigger model
layers. For example, if performing a 10-point sweep, the trigger counter would be
set to 10. Operation will stay in the Trigger Layer until the 10 source-delay-mea-
sure points of the sweep are performed.
If you wanted to repeat the sweep three times, the arm counter would be set to
three. Three 10-point sweeps can then be performed for a total of 30
source-delay-measure actions. Refer to the examples at the end of this section.
The maximum buffer size for the SourceMeter is 2500 readings. The product of
the two counter values cannot exceed 2500. For example, if you set an arm count
of two, the maximum trigger count will be 1250 (2500 / 2 = 1250). However, you
can set the arm count to INFINITE. With an infinite arm count, the maximum trig-
ger count is 2500.
NOTE When a sweep is configured, the trigger model settings will not change
until the sweep is started. After the sweep is finished, the trigger model
will reset to the previous settings.
Output triggers
The SourceMeter can be programmed to output a trigger (via rear panel Trigger
Link connector) after various trigger model operations. An output trigger is used to
trigger another instrument to perform an operation. See “Trigger link,” page 11-19,
for more information.
Trigger Layer Output Triggers — After each action (Source, Delay, and Measure),
the SourceMeter can be programmed to send out an output trigger if Trigger Link
is the selected Trigger-In Source. For example, if the Trigger Out Event for Mea-
sure is ON, an output trigger will be sent after the Measure action. When used
with a scanner, an output trigger after each measurement can signal the scanner
to select the next channel in the scan.
